THE SPECTRE OF HOPE
SYNOPSIS
A documentary based on the latest work of photographer Sebastião Salgado. Salgado spent 6 years traveling to over 40 countries, taking pictures of globalization and its consequences - most notably, the mass migrations of populations around the world. In the film, Salgado presents his remarkable photographs in conversation with John Berger.
